Decadent Baileys Chocolate Cheesecake Trifle

Ingredients
  

For the Chocolate Cheesecake Layer:

8 oz (226g) cream cheese, softened

1 cup powdered sugar

1/2 cup unsweetened cocoa powder

1 cup heavy whipping cream

1/4 cup Baileys Irish Cream

1 tsp vanilla extract

For the Chocolate Cake Layer:

1 box (15.25 oz) chocolate cake mix

Ingredients required on the cake mix box (usually eggs, oil, and water)

For the Whipped Cream Layer:

2 cups heavy cream

1/4 cup powdered sugar

1 tsp vanilla extract

Chocolate shavings or curls, for garnish

For Assembly:

1 cup chocolate syrup

1/4 cup Baileys Irish Cream (optional, for drizzling)

Instructions
 

Prepare the Chocolate Cake:

    - Preheat your oven as directed on the cake mix box. Grease and flour two 9-inch round cake pans.

      - Prepare the chocolate cake batter according to the package instructions and pour it evenly into the prepared pans.

        - Bake for the allotted time, then check for doneness with a toothpick. Let the cakes cool completely before removing them from the pans.

          Make the Chocolate Cheesecake Layer:

            - In a large mixing bowl, beat the softened cream cheese with powdered sugar and cocoa powder until smooth and creamy.

              - In another bowl, whip the heavy cream until soft peaks form. Gently fold the whipped cream into the cream cheese mixture until well combined.

                - Add in the Baileys Irish Cream and vanilla extract, and stir until everything is incorporated. Place this mixture in the refrigerator to set slightly for about 30 minutes.

                  Prepare the Whipped Cream:

                    - In a mixing bowl, whip the heavy cream until soft peaks form. Gradually add in the powdered sugar and vanilla extract, and continue whipping until you reach stiff peaks. Set aside.

                      Assemble the Trifle:

                        - Cut the cooled chocolate cakes into small cubes.

                          - In a large trifle dish or individual serving glasses, layer the trifle starting with a layer of chocolate cake cubes at the bottom.

                            - Drizzle a thin layer of chocolate syrup over the cake, followed by a generous scoop of the chocolate cheesecake mixture.

                              - Next, add a layer of whipped cream on top.

                                - Repeat the layers until you reach the top of your trifle dish, finishing with a layer of whipped cream.

                                  Garnish and Serve:

                                    - Drizzle extra Baileys Irish Cream, if desired, and top with chocolate shavings or curls for an elegant finish.

                                      - Refrigerate the trifle for at least 2 hours before serving to let the flavors meld together.

                                        Prep Time, Total Time, Servings:

                                          30 minutes | 3 hours (including chilling) | 8-10 servings
